Description Malte Starostik 2002-11-01 14:53:03 UTC
Version:           1.5 (using KDE 3.0.9 (KDE 3.1 RC1))
Installed from:    compiled sources
Compiler:          gcc version 3.2 (Mandrake Linux 9.0 3.2-1mdk)
OS:          Linux (i686) release 2.4.19-16mdk

The following seems to happen only after I emptied some folders from a different client machine.
If a folder contains a single message and that one has status "New", it's impossible to mark it read w/o explicit Message->Mark Message->Read or shortcut. Selecting it with the mouse keeps it as new, even after I click elsewhere in the header list and then again select the message it stays as new.
Also I saw but cannot trigger now a similar behaviour:
* 2nd message arrives in the folder
* User selects the folder => first message is selected and shown as read
* User selects the 2nd message, maybe this only works with Numpad-+
* First message is shown as new again
* After another Numpad-+ hit, all is fine
As soon as the first (or first two) messages are really marked read, everything works as epected again.
